The Disney+ series is finally drawing near and Marvel has been busy promoting WandaVision with multiple posters that tease the numerous decades the show is set in. But, plenty of mysteries still remain about the plot of the show, such as how Vision is still there after Scarlet Witch destroyed the Mind Stone during Infinity War. Previous trailers saw Vision face the possibility of him being dead, and now a new trailer shows the destruction of the Mind Stone again.
As part of Disney's Investor Day 2020, Marvel Studios released a new trailer for WandaVision that focuses on Wanda and Vision's new suburban lives. The footage includes new looks at several of the familiar MCU characters who will appear and sets up a storyline of the two Avengers fighting to protect their current home, wherever it might be.
The second WandaVision trailer is packed with brand new footage for the series, although Marvel Studios is still doing an excellent job not revealing too much. Wanda watching the Mind Stone explode again is likely a result of how she is trying to process the loss of Vision in the real world. While the PTSD from such an event was a reason many fans believed Wanda created this altered reality she and Vision now exist in, all of the marketing has people asking who is doing this to Wanda. So, her new life might not totally be in her control.
